According to an October YouGov poll, Black and Hispanic Americans hold a more positive view of Planned Parenthood, Black Lives Matter (BLM), and the Anti-Defamation League (ADL) compared to White Americans. The findings indicate a significant difference in perceptions among these racial and ethnic groups regarding these organizations.

The poll results highlight the varying levels of support and approval for these entities, reflecting broader social attitudes within different communities. This data may contribute to ongoing discussions about social justice and community engagement.
